Dhanaghara - Dharakote, Ganjam
Dhanaghara is a village situated in the Dharakote tehsil of Ganjam district, Odisha. It is located approximately 42 km from Gangapur and around 84 km from Chatrapur. Jhadabandha serves as the Gram Panchayat for Dhanaghara village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Dhanaghara is 410739. The village covers a total geographical area of 43 hectares and falls under the 761123 pincode. Asika is the nearest town, located about 17 km away.
Dhanaghara village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sanakhemundi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Aska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
